mirror of
https://gitlab.com/davical-project/davical.git
synced 2026-05-21 01:54:23 +00:00
Remove defunct code.
This commit is contained in:
parent
49257629ea
commit
d49d2dc935
@ -1,40 +0,0 @@
|
||||
<?php
|
||||
require_once("../inc/always.php");
|
||||
require_once("DAViCalSession.php");
|
||||
$session->LoginRequired();
|
||||
|
||||
require_once("interactive-page.php");
|
||||
|
||||
|
||||
require_once("classBrowser.php");
|
||||
$c->stylesheets[] = "css/browse.css";
|
||||
|
||||
$c->page_title = "System Roles";
|
||||
$browser = new Browser($c->page_title);
|
||||
|
||||
$browser->AddColumn( 'role_no', 'No.', '', '##role_link##' );
|
||||
$browser->AddColumn( 'role_name', 'Name' );
|
||||
$browser->AddHidden( 'role_link', "'<a href=\"/role.php?role_no=' || role_no || '\">' || role_no || '</a>'" );
|
||||
|
||||
$browser->SetJoins( "roles" );
|
||||
|
||||
if ( isset( $_GET['o']) && isset($_GET['d']) ) {
|
||||
$browser->AddOrder( $_GET['o'], $_GET['d'] );
|
||||
}
|
||||
else
|
||||
$browser->AddOrder( 'role_no', 'A' );
|
||||
|
||||
$browser->RowFormat( "<tr onMouseover=\"LinkHref(this,1);\" title=\"Click to Display Role Detail\" class=\"r%d\">\n", "</tr>\n", '#even' );
|
||||
$browser->DoQuery();
|
||||
|
||||
|
||||
// if ( $session->AllowedTo("Admin") )
|
||||
$role_menu->AddOption("New Role","/role.php?create","Add a new role", false, 10);
|
||||
|
||||
$active_menu_pattern = "#^/role#";
|
||||
|
||||
include("page-header.php");
|
||||
|
||||
echo $browser->Render();
|
||||
include("page-footer.php");
|
||||
?>
|
||||
@ -1,26 +0,0 @@
|
||||
<?php
|
||||
require_once("../inc/always.php");
|
||||
require_once("DAViCalSession.php");
|
||||
$session->LoginRequired();
|
||||
|
||||
header('Content-type: text/plain; charset="UTF-8"');
|
||||
|
||||
require("AwlQuery.php");
|
||||
|
||||
echo "Creating query #1...\n";
|
||||
$qry = new AwlQuery('SELECT * FROM collection WHERE is_calendar = :calendarness', array( ':calendarness' => true ) );
|
||||
echo "Executing query...\n";
|
||||
if ( $qry->Exec() ) {
|
||||
while( $row = $qry->Fetch() ) {
|
||||
printf( ' --> %-50.50s %s '."\n", $row->dav_name, $row->resourcetypes );
|
||||
}
|
||||
}
|
||||
|
||||
echo "Creating query #2...\n";
|
||||
$qry = new AwlQuery('SELECT * FROM collection WHERE is_calendar = false');
|
||||
echo "Executing query...\n";
|
||||
if ( $qry->Exec() ) {
|
||||
while( $row = $qry->Fetch() ) {
|
||||
printf( ' --> %-45.45s %s '."\n", $row->dav_name, $row->resourcetypes );
|
||||
}
|
||||
}
|
||||
@ -1,69 +0,0 @@
|
||||
<?php
|
||||
/**
|
||||
* Display a list of all users
|
||||
*
|
||||
* @package davical
|
||||
* @subpackage Admin
|
||||
* @author Andrew McMillan <andrew@catalyst.net.nz>
|
||||
* @copyright Catalyst .Net Ltd
|
||||
* @license http://gnu.org/copyleft/gpl.html GNU GPL v2
|
||||
*/
|
||||
require_once('../inc/always.php');
|
||||
require_once('DAViCalSession.php');
|
||||
$session->LoginRequired();
|
||||
|
||||
require_once('interactive-page.php');
|
||||
|
||||
/**
|
||||
* Translate relationship names in the relationship_list for each user. See
|
||||
* the documentation for classBrowser::BrowserColumn for the definition of
|
||||
* the hook function parameters.
|
||||
*/
|
||||
function translate_relationship_list( $value, $field, $row ) {
|
||||
global $relationship_names;
|
||||
foreach( $relationship_names AS $k => $v ) {
|
||||
$value = str_replace( $k, $v, $value );
|
||||
}
|
||||
return $value;
|
||||
}
|
||||
|
||||
$relationship_names = array();
|
||||
$qry = new PgQuery( 'SELECT rt_name FROM relationship_type' );
|
||||
if ( $qry->Exec('users') && $qry->rows > 0 ) {
|
||||
while( $relationship = $qry->Fetch() ) {
|
||||
$relationship_names[$relationship->rt_name] = translate($relationship->rt_name);
|
||||
}
|
||||
}
|
||||
|
||||
require_once('classBrowser.php');
|
||||
$c->stylesheets[] = 'css/browse.css';
|
||||
$c->scripts[] = 'js/browse.js';
|
||||
|
||||
$browser = new Browser(translate('Calendar Users'));
|
||||
|
||||
$browser->AddColumn( 'user_no', translate('No.'), 'right', '##user_link##' );
|
||||
$browser->AddColumn( 'username', translate('Name') );
|
||||
$browser->AddHidden( 'user_link', "'<a href=\"$c->base_url/usr.php?user_no=' || user_no || '\">' || user_no || '</a>'" );
|
||||
$browser->AddColumn( 'fullname', translate('Full Name') );
|
||||
$browser->AddColumn( 'email', translate('EMail') );
|
||||
$browser->AddColumn( 'relations', translate('Relationships'), '', '', 'relationship_list(user_no)', '', '', 'translate_relationship_list' );
|
||||
$browser->SetOrdering( 'username', 'A' );
|
||||
|
||||
$browser->SetJoins( 'usr' );
|
||||
|
||||
if ( $c->enable_row_linking ) {
|
||||
$browser->RowFormat( '<tr onMouseover="LinkHref(this,1);" title="'.translate('Click to display user details').'" class="r%d">', '</tr>', '#even' );
|
||||
}
|
||||
else {
|
||||
$browser->RowFormat( '<tr class="r%d">', '</tr>', '#even' );
|
||||
}
|
||||
$browser->DoQuery();
|
||||
|
||||
$c->page_title = translate('Calendar Users');
|
||||
|
||||
|
||||
include('page-header.php');
|
||||
|
||||
echo $browser->Render();
|
||||
|
||||
include('page-footer.php');
|
||||
@ -1,67 +0,0 @@
|
||||
<?php
|
||||
require_once("../inc/always.php");
|
||||
require_once("DAViCalSession.php");
|
||||
|
||||
// This page requires login.
|
||||
$session->LoginRequired();
|
||||
require_once("interactive-page.php");
|
||||
|
||||
require_once("DAViCalUser.php");
|
||||
|
||||
$user_no = intval(isset($_POST['user_no']) ? $_POST['user_no'] : (isset($_GET['user_no'])?$_GET['user_no']:0) );
|
||||
$user = new DAViCalUser($user_no);
|
||||
if ( 'insert' == $user->WriteType && $user->user_no > 0 ) {
|
||||
$user = new DAViCalUser(0);
|
||||
}
|
||||
if ( $user->user_no == 0 ) {
|
||||
$c->page_title = ( $user_no != "" ? translate("User Unavailable") : translate("New User") );
|
||||
}
|
||||
else {
|
||||
$c->page_title = sprintf("%s (%s)", $user->Get("fullname"), $user->Get("username"));
|
||||
}
|
||||
$show = 0;
|
||||
|
||||
if ( !$session->just_logged_in && (isset($_POST['submit']) || isset($_GET['action'])) ) {
|
||||
if ( $session->AllowedTo("Admin") || $session->AllowedTo("Support")
|
||||
|| ($user->user_no > 0 && $user->user_no == $session->user_no) ) {
|
||||
$session->Log( "DBG: Record %s write type is %s.", $user->Table, $user->WriteType );
|
||||
if ( isset($_POST['submit']) ) {
|
||||
$user->PostToValues();
|
||||
if ( $user->Validate() ) {
|
||||
$user->Write();
|
||||
$user = new DAViCalUser($user->user_no);
|
||||
$user->EditMode = true;
|
||||
if ( $user->user_no == 0 ) {
|
||||
$c->page_title = ( $user_no != "" ? translate("User Unavailable") : translate("New User") );
|
||||
}
|
||||
else {
|
||||
$c->page_title = $user->Get("user_no"). " - " . $user->Get("fullname");
|
||||
}
|
||||
}
|
||||
}
|
||||
else {
|
||||
/**
|
||||
* Handle any actions, such as 'delete_relation'
|
||||
*/
|
||||
if ( $user->HandleAction($_GET['action']) ) {
|
||||
$user = new DAViCalUser($user->user_no);
|
||||
$user->EditMode = true;
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
$related_menu->AddOption( sprintf(translate("Edit %s"), $user->Get('fullname')), $c->base_url.'/usr.php?user_no='.$user->user_no.'&edit=1', translate("Edit this user record"), true, 900 );
|
||||
$related_menu->AddOption( sprintf(translate("View %s"), $user->Get('fullname')), $c->base_url.'/usr.php?user_no='.$user->user_no, translate("View this user record"), true, 900 );
|
||||
if ( $user->user_no > 0 ) {
|
||||
if ( $user->AllowedTo('update') && ! $user->EditMode ) {
|
||||
$related_menu->AddOption( sprintf(translate("Edit %s"), $user->Get('fullname')), "$c->base_url/usr.php?user_no=$user->user_no&edit=1", translate("Edit this user record"), true, 900 );
|
||||
}
|
||||
else {
|
||||
$related_menu->AddOption( sprintf(translate("View %s"), $user->Get('fullname')), "$c->base_url/usr.php?user_no=$user->user_no", translate("View this user record"), true, 900 );
|
||||
}
|
||||
}
|
||||
|
||||
include("page-header.php");
|
||||
echo $user->Render($c->page_title);
|
||||
include("page-footer.php");
|
||||
Loading…
x
Reference in New Issue
Block a user